Just another build thread, sorta

I'm doing a pretty substantial build with some frag tanks that I got a good deal on. They aren't going to be show tanks but serve a more utilitarian purpose. There's 4 tanks and they are 96x14x10. I'm considering using a 40b as a central sump since I have one available.
